Western Illinois University's track team honored for academic excellence

The Western Illinois University Women's Track and Field team has been recognized by the U.S. Track & Field and Cross Country Coaches Association (USTFCCCA) for their academic performance during the 2024-25 season. The team earned the USTFCCCA Women's Track and Field All-Academic Team status.

The Leathernecks achieved a 3.38 GPA to qualify for this recognition. According to the criteria, teams must have a GPA of 3.0 or above in the current academic year to earn USTFCCCA All-Academic status.
